Question... how do I get rid of the warp (the "fish eye") from the Phantom Vision? Is this a setting, or do I do that in editing? I use Premiere Pro for all of my video editing.

4wd said:
There is a lens correction filter in Premiere Pro, it wants to be on about -17 to remove it entirely but you can use less and keep more from around the edge.
